Yahoo OCP: Unveiling The Tech Giant's Open Compute Project
Hey tech enthusiasts! Ever heard of Yahoo OCP? If you're knee-deep in the world of data centers, cloud computing, or just plain fascinated by how the internet giants do their thing, then you're in the right place. Today, we're diving deep into Yahoo's Open Compute Project (OCP) journey. This is a story of innovation, efficiency, and a whole lot of open-source goodness. So, buckle up, grab your favorite beverage, and let's unravel the mysteries of Yahoo's OCP efforts, looking at the driving forces, and the resulting benefits. Get ready to have your minds blown!
Understanding the Basics: What is Yahoo OCP?
Alright, first things first: What exactly is Yahoo OCP? It's crucial to grasp the fundamental concepts before we get into the nitty-gritty. In a nutshell, Yahoo OCP refers to Yahoo's implementation of the Open Compute Project. The Open Compute Project itself is an open-source hardware initiative that was originally spearheaded by Facebook. The core idea? To design and build more efficient, scalable, and sustainable data center infrastructure. Think of it as a collaborative effort where companies share their hardware designs, specifications, and best practices to drive down costs, improve performance, and reduce environmental impact.
Now, Yahoo wasn't just a passive observer in this grand scheme. They jumped right in, adapting and contributing to the OCP ecosystem. They saw the potential to overhaul their own data centers, replacing proprietary hardware with open, standardized designs. This move allowed Yahoo to have more control over their infrastructure, tailor it to their specific needs, and benefit from the collective knowledge and innovation of the OCP community. This is super important because it speaks to a fundamental shift in the tech industry: moving away from closed, vendor-locked systems towards open, collaborative approaches. For Yahoo, this transition was all about gaining agility, optimizing resources, and ultimately, delivering a better experience for their users.
This involved a complete overhaul of their data center infrastructure, replacing traditional proprietary hardware with OCP-designed servers, storage systems, and networking equipment. This wasn't just about swapping out one set of components for another; it was a fundamental shift in how Yahoo approached its computing needs. The emphasis was on standardization, modularity, and energy efficiency. By adopting OCP principles, Yahoo aimed to achieve several key objectives: to reduce capital expenditures (CAPEX), to lower operational expenses (OPEX), to improve server performance, and to minimize the environmental footprint of its data centers. Pretty ambitious, right? But the results, as we'll see, were quite impressive. So, Yahoo's OCP journey is more than just a tech story; it's a testament to the power of open collaboration and the pursuit of efficiency in the digital age. It's about building a better, more sustainable future for the internet, one data center at a time.
The Driving Forces Behind Yahoo's OCP Adoption
So, what motivated Yahoo to embrace the Open Compute Project? What were the key drivers that pushed them to make such a significant shift in their infrastructure strategy? The answers lie in a combination of factors, ranging from the desire to reduce costs to the need to improve performance and agility. Let's break down some of the main forces that shaped Yahoo's OCP adoption.
- Cost Optimization: One of the most compelling reasons for Yahoo to join the OCP was the potential for significant cost savings. Traditional data center hardware is often expensive, with proprietary designs and vendor lock-in driving up prices. The OCP model, on the other hand, promotes open standards and commoditized hardware components, which allows companies to procure equipment at a lower cost. Yahoo recognized that by embracing OCP, it could reduce its capital expenditures (CAPEX) on hardware, as well as lower its operational expenses (OPEX) related to maintenance and power consumption. The economics were simply too good to ignore. By leveraging open designs and a competitive market, Yahoo could drive down the overall cost of its infrastructure and free up resources for other critical initiatives.
 - Performance and Scalability: Another major driver for Yahoo was the need to improve the performance and scalability of its data center infrastructure. The company was constantly dealing with massive amounts of data and intense computing demands, and it needed a platform that could handle the load. The OCP's focus on efficient hardware designs and modularity offered a solution. OCP servers and storage systems are often optimized for specific workloads, providing better performance than traditional, general-purpose hardware. Moreover, the modular nature of OCP designs makes it easier to scale up or down as needed. Yahoo could quickly add more servers or storage capacity to meet growing demands without being constrained by proprietary hardware limitations. This flexibility was crucial for keeping up with the rapid growth of its user base and the ever-increasing demands of its services.
 - Energy Efficiency: Sustainability was also a key consideration for Yahoo. Data centers are notorious for their high energy consumption, and Yahoo was committed to reducing its environmental footprint. The OCP's emphasis on energy-efficient designs aligned perfectly with this goal. OCP hardware often incorporates features such as advanced power management, optimized cooling systems, and more efficient components. By adopting OCP designs, Yahoo could significantly reduce the power consumption of its data centers. This not only lowered operational costs but also helped the company meet its sustainability goals and contribute to a greener future.
 - Innovation and Agility: Yahoo also saw OCP as a way to foster innovation and improve its agility. The open-source nature of the OCP ecosystem encourages collaboration and knowledge sharing. Yahoo could tap into the collective expertise of the OCP community, learn from other companies, and contribute its own innovations. This collaborative environment accelerated the pace of innovation and allowed Yahoo to stay ahead of the curve. Furthermore, the modularity and standardization of OCP designs made it easier for Yahoo to deploy new technologies and adapt to changing business needs. This increased agility was crucial for staying competitive in the fast-paced world of the internet. By embracing OCP, Yahoo was able to build a more flexible, adaptable, and innovative infrastructure that supported its long-term growth and success.
 
The Benefits: What Yahoo Gained from OCP Implementation
Alright, so Yahoo took the plunge. They jumped into the world of OCP. But what did they get out of it? What were the tangible benefits that made all the effort worthwhile? The answer, as you might guess, is a lot. Implementing OCP brought a range of advantages, from cost savings to performance improvements and greater flexibility. Let's delve into some of the key benefits Yahoo reaped.
- Cost Reduction: One of the most significant benefits was a dramatic reduction in costs. By adopting OCP hardware, Yahoo could slash its capital expenditures (CAPEX) on hardware. They could procure servers, storage, and networking equipment at a lower cost, thanks to open designs and a competitive market. Furthermore, they experienced lower operational expenses (OPEX) due to improved energy efficiency and reduced maintenance costs. This cost-effectiveness freed up resources that could be used for other strategic initiatives.
 - Improved Performance: Yahoo experienced a boost in performance across its data centers. OCP hardware is often optimized for specific workloads, leading to faster processing speeds and improved responsiveness. They were able to handle the massive volumes of data and intense computing demands with greater efficiency. This translated into a better user experience, with faster loading times and more reliable services. This is super important because in the online world, every millisecond counts.
 - Increased Scalability: Yahoo gained the ability to scale its infrastructure more easily and efficiently. The modularity of OCP designs made it simple to add more servers or storage capacity as needed. They could quickly respond to growing demand without being constrained by proprietary hardware limitations. This scalability was crucial for supporting the company's rapid growth and the ever-increasing demands of its services. The ability to quickly scale resources is a key advantage in the dynamic world of the internet, where user demand can change in an instant.
 - Enhanced Energy Efficiency: Yahoo significantly improved the energy efficiency of its data centers. OCP hardware incorporates features like advanced power management, optimized cooling systems, and more efficient components. As a result, Yahoo was able to reduce its power consumption, lowering operational costs and minimizing its environmental footprint. This commitment to energy efficiency aligned with the company's sustainability goals and contributed to a greener future. Energy efficiency is not only good for the planet but also makes good business sense.
 - Greater Flexibility and Agility: OCP provided Yahoo with increased flexibility and agility in its infrastructure management. The open-source nature of the OCP ecosystem encouraged collaboration and knowledge sharing. Yahoo could tap into the collective expertise of the OCP community and contribute its own innovations. The modularity and standardization of OCP designs made it easier to deploy new technologies and adapt to changing business needs. This agility was crucial for staying competitive in the fast-paced world of the internet. Yahoo could quickly adopt new technologies and adjust its infrastructure to meet evolving demands, giving them a significant advantage over competitors.
 
The Impact on Yahoo's Data Centers
How did all this translate into the nuts and bolts of Yahoo's data centers? Implementing OCP had a profound impact on their physical infrastructure, as well as their operational strategies. Let's take a closer look at the changes and improvements that Yahoo made. This is where the rubber meets the road, guys!
- Hardware Transformation: Yahoo's data centers underwent a significant hardware transformation. They replaced traditional proprietary servers, storage systems, and networking equipment with OCP-designed components. This included custom-built servers optimized for specific workloads, modular storage solutions, and energy-efficient networking gear. This transformation was a massive undertaking, but it was essential for realizing the benefits of OCP. The new hardware was designed to be more efficient, scalable, and cost-effective than the previous generation.
 - Software and Management Systems: The transition to OCP also involved changes to Yahoo's software and management systems. They implemented open-source management tools and developed custom software to monitor and control their OCP infrastructure. This included tools for automated provisioning, capacity planning, and performance monitoring. The open-source nature of OCP allowed Yahoo to tailor its software and management systems to its specific needs, providing greater flexibility and control. This enabled Yahoo to manage its data center infrastructure more efficiently, with greater automation and real-time monitoring.
 - Power and Cooling Infrastructure: Another area of focus was the power and cooling infrastructure. Yahoo invested in more efficient power distribution units (PDUs) and cooling systems to reduce energy consumption and improve overall efficiency. They also explored innovative cooling technologies, such as liquid cooling and free cooling, to further reduce their environmental footprint. This focus on power and cooling was a critical part of Yahoo's commitment to sustainability and cost reduction.
 - Data Center Design: The overall design of Yahoo's data centers was also optimized for OCP. This included changes to the layout of servers, the placement of cooling units, and the organization of cabling. The goal was to maximize efficiency and optimize airflow, resulting in better performance and lower energy consumption. The data center design was aligned with the principles of OCP, which emphasized modularity, standardization, and ease of maintenance. Yahoo's data centers were transformed into modern, efficient, and sustainable facilities capable of handling the company's massive computing needs.
 
Conclusion: The Legacy of Yahoo OCP
So, what's the takeaway from Yahoo's OCP adventure? What lessons can we learn from their journey? In short, Yahoo's embrace of the Open Compute Project was a resounding success. They realized significant cost savings, improved performance, enhanced scalability, and increased energy efficiency. Their story is a powerful example of how open-source collaboration and innovative hardware designs can transform data center infrastructure. The legacy of Yahoo OCP continues to shape the tech landscape.
Key Takeaways and Lessons Learned
- Embrace Open Collaboration: Yahoo's success underscores the importance of embracing open collaboration. The OCP model, where companies share hardware designs and best practices, fostered innovation and accelerated the pace of technological advancement. The willingness to collaborate and share knowledge is a key factor in driving progress in the tech industry.
 - Prioritize Efficiency and Sustainability: Yahoo's focus on efficiency and sustainability set a high standard for the industry. By adopting energy-efficient hardware and optimizing its data center designs, Yahoo demonstrated its commitment to a greener future. The lessons learned from Yahoo's OCP implementation continue to inspire other companies to prioritize sustainability in their operations.
 - Adapt and Innovate: Yahoo's journey highlights the importance of adapting and innovating. They took the basic principles of OCP and tailored them to their specific needs, developing custom solutions and contributing to the open-source community. The ability to adapt to changing circumstances and embrace innovation is crucial for staying ahead in the fast-paced world of technology.
 - The Power of Open Source: Yahoo's experience showcases the power of open source. By leveraging open standards and open-source software, they gained greater flexibility, control, and access to a wider pool of expertise. Open source allows companies to tap into a wealth of knowledge and accelerate the development of new technologies.
 - Future Impact and Evolution: The legacy of Yahoo OCP continues to influence the tech industry. Their contributions to the OCP community have helped shape the future of data center infrastructure, and their lessons learned continue to inspire other companies to embrace open collaboration, prioritize efficiency, and drive innovation. Yahoo's story serves as a reminder that open-source initiatives can transform industries and create a more sustainable future. The evolution of data centers is an ongoing process, and the principles championed by Yahoo OCP will continue to guide the way.
 
As the tech industry continues to evolve, the principles of open collaboration, efficiency, and sustainability will only become more important. The Yahoo OCP story serves as an inspiration and a roadmap for others seeking to build a better, more efficient, and more sustainable future for the internet. That's all, folks! Hope you enjoyed the dive into Yahoo OCP! Keep exploring, keep innovating, and keep looking for ways to build a better tech future. Catch ya later!